Comprehensive Guide to Appeal Form

What is the Group Benefit Appeal Form?

The Group Benefit Appeal Form is a vital document used for appealing denied or partially paid medical claims. It is crucial for both patients and providers as it allows them to formally contest insurance decisions regarding coverage for medical services. This form is essential in navigating the complexities of healthcare payments and ensuring that entitled benefits are received.
By utilizing the healthcare appeal form, individuals can properly outline their reasons for challenging a claim denial, making it easier for insurance companies to review their cases thoroughly.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ials

To support a successful appeal, certain documents must accompany the Group Benefit Appeal Form. Essential supporting documentation may include:
  • A copy of the denied claim and any explanations of benefits (EOBs).
  • Relevant medical records or notes from healthcare providers.
  • Any correspondence with the insurance provider regarding the claim.
Inclusion of comprehensive information helps ensure that the appeal is well-informed and backed by necessary evidence.
